EDITORS COMMENTS
This print captures a rare glimpse into the world of the Gordon Highlanders as they meticulously craft their iconic kilts. Taken by an English photographer in the 19th century, this image showcases the regiment's dedication to tradition and attention to detail. In this snapshot, we see a group of skilled tailors diligently sewing yards of cloth in a bustling barrack. The room is filled with the rhythmic hum of sewing machines, creating an atmosphere that exudes both precision and camaraderie. Each tailor focuses intently on their task, ensuring every stitch aligns perfectly to create these timeless garments. The significance of kilts for the Gordon Highlanders cannot be overstated. These distinctive tartan skirts are not only a symbol of Scottish heritage but also represent unity within the regiment. As each kilt takes shape under expert hands, it becomes more than just clothing; it becomes part of their identity. Located in Aberdeen, Scotland, this regiment has long been renowned for its impeccable dress standards. This photograph beautifully captures their commitment to maintaining those traditions through generations. Preserved in a private collection and featured in Pictorial Scotland and Ireland (Cassell, c 1895), this image offers us a window into history - reminding us of the craftsmanship and pride that went into creating these iconic uniforms worn by members of one of Scotland's most esteemed military regiments.
